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Longbridge to Staines start from as little as £12.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Longbridge to Staines start from £54.00 one way, or £55.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Longbridge to Staines are available for £81.20 one way, or £155.60 return

Station Details and Facilities

Longbridge Station is equipped with facilities designed to make your journey as seamless as possible. The ticket office is readily accessible six days a week, from 6:00 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ays, providing all the assistance you might need. On Sundays, it opens from 9:30 AM to 3:00 PM. Ticket machines are available, ensuring that purchasing and collecting pre-bought tickets is hassle-free. An induction loop is available for passengers with hearing impairments, further enhancing accessibility.

For those requiring step-free access, Longbridge Station does not disappoint. Classified under a category 'A' for accessibility, it offers step-free access to all platforms. While there are no waiting rooms, seating areas are available for those who prefer to rest while they await their journeys. Convenient facilities, such as accessible toilets, are located in the booking hall and are available during ticket office hours.

Comprehensive Facilities for Every Traveler

Staines station prides itself on its customer-friendly amenities. With ticket offices open from early to late, purchasing your ticket or collecting an online purchase is straightforward and hassle-free. The presence of smartcard validators further streamlines the commuting process. For those needing assistance, staff are available for support throughout the day, ensuring everyone can travel with ease and confidence.

The station guarantees accessibility for all passengers, offering step-free access across the station. Alongside accessible ticket machines and toilets, facilities such as induction loops and ramps for train access ensure a smooth journey for those with additional mobility needs. Waiting areas, seating, and wheelchair availability add layers of comfort and accessibility for all visitors.
